Abstract
Способ добывания через шлюзовое устройство шлаков из водяной ванны реактора для получения синтез-газа, согласно которому шлаки с помощью шлюзового резервуара переводят на более низкий уровень давления. В области выпуска шлаков из водяной ванны газогенератора или же из окружающего этот газогенератор напорного резервуара в поток шлаков подают поток холодной воды в области большего поперечного сечения, чем поперечное сечение входного штуцера шлюзового резервуара, таким образом, что в области выпуска становится возможным температурное расслоение.
